The recent twists and turns in Texas' hemp legislation have left industry professionals and enthusiasts speculating about the future. On this episode of SNEED-CAST, Quinton pairs up with Ken to welcome back Chelsie Spencer, a legal expert in the cannabis industry. Chelsie, a founding partner at Ritter Spencer Chang and recognized as a super lawyer in the cannabis space, shares insights on pivotal topics concerning Texas' hemp ecosystem.The discussion kicks off with a deep-dive into Governor Abbott's recent veto of SB3, a controversial bill proposing a ban on hemp in Texas. Chelsea provides invaluable commentary on the legal, economic, and social implications of such legislation, highlighting the industry backlash and the significant influence of conservative voices urging a veto.
